Vehicle Dimensions

Тhere is barely any difference in dimensions between the two vehicles. The Skoda Octavia 1.4 TSI G-TEC is just 0.6 inches shorter, 0.2 inches wider and 0.6 inches taller than the Mercedes C 350 e.
